Touring cycling routes around Hohengandern are set within the picturesque Eichsfeld region of Thuringia, Germany. The landscape is characterized by a blend of hilly forests, green meadows, and rolling hills, with the Werra River meandering through the area. This topography provides varied cycling experiences, from mostly paved, gentle sections along the river to routes with moderate climbs. The region offers diverse terrain suitable for different levels of touring cyclists.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available around Hohengandern?

There are over 330 touring cycling routes around Hohengandern, offering a wide range of options for different skill levels and preferences. This includes 93 easy routes, 136 moderate routes, and 103 difficult routes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Hohengandern?

The terrain around Hohengandern is diverse, characterized by a charming blend of hilly forests, green meadows, and rolling hills. The Werra River meanders through the landscape, providing scenic riverside routes that are often paved and gentle. Other routes feature moderate climbs, offering varying degrees of challenge. The broader region also includes parts of the UNESCO Biosphere Reserve Rhön, known for its open vistas and diverse ecosystems.

Are there routes su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, Hohengandern offers 93 easy touring cycling routes, many of which follow the scenic Werra River or other gentle paths. An excellent option for an easy ride is the Leine Cycle Path – Leine cycle path loop from Arenshausen, which is 29.8 km long and takes about 1 hour 45 minutes to complete.

What are some challenging touring cycling routes in the area?

For those seeking a challenge, there are 103 difficult routes around Hohengandern. A notable option is the Bike loop from Arenshausen, an 89.8 km trail with significant elevation gain, typically completed in about 5 hours 27 minutes. Another challenging route is the Leine Cycle Path – Rustebach Water Crossing loop from Arenshausen, which covers 34.7 km with 373 meters of elevation gain.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es around Hohengandern?

Many of the touring cycling routes around Hohengandern are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the popular Witzenhausen Old Town – Witzenhausen Town Hall loop from Eichenberg is a moderate 16.1 km circular path that offers a mix of historical townscapes and natural scenery.

What natural features or viewpoints can I discover along the routes?

The region boasts several natural features and viewpoints. You can enjoy expansive views from elevated points like the Nüssekuppe (410 meters high) or the Kelle - Teufelskanzel. The Werra River itself is a dominant natural feature, providing scenic riverside cycling. The Hurkutstein Rock Formation and Hermit's Cave is also a notable natural monument you might encounter.

Are there any historical or cultural landmarks to see while cycling?

Yes, the area around Hohengandern is rich in history and culture. The Werra Cycle Path passes through charming half-timbered towns and cultural monuments. You can also find traces of the former inner-German border, with sites like the Grenzmuseum "Schifflersgrund" offering a unique historical dimension. Hanstein Castle is another historic attraction in the broader Eichsfeld region that can be integrated into longer tours.

Can I find lakes or caves near the cycling routes?

Yes, there are several natural attractions like lakes and caves in the vicinity. Notable lakes include the Wendebach Reservoir, Grüner See Hundelshausen, and Speerberg Pond. For caves, besides the Hurkutstein Rock Formation and Hermit's Cave, you can also explore the Dwarf Cave and Abri Walterstein I and Dreilochnadel.

Is the Werra Cycle Path accessible from Hohengandern?

Yes, Hohengandern is well-situated for accessing the Werra Cycle Path (Werratal Cycle Route). This well-developed, 306-kilometer route follows the Werra River, offering idyllic sections through green meadows and rolling hills, with opportunities to stop in historic towns. It's a major draw for touring cyclists in the region.

What is the best time of year for touring cycling in Hohengandern?

The spring, summer, and early autumn months generally offer the most pleasant conditions for touring cycling in Hohengandern. During these seasons, the weather is typically mild, and the landscapes are vibrant with green meadows and forests. Late autumn can also be beautiful with changing foliage, though temperatures will be cooler.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y the most about cycling in Hohengandern?

The touring cycling routes around Hohengandern are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.6 stars from over 2,600 reviews. Cyclists often praise the varied terrain, from gentle riverside paths to routes with moderate climbs, and the picturesque blend of hilly forests, green meadows, and the scenic Werra River.

Are there options for longer, multi-day touring cycling adventures?

Yes, the region's connection to the extensive Werra Cycle Path, which spans 306 kilometers, makes it an excellent starting point for multi-day touring adventures. You can plan longer journeys along the river, exploring varied landscapes and charming towns across Thuringia, Hesse, and Lower Saxony.

Are there any routes that offer views of the UNESCO Biosphere Reserve Rhön?

While Hohengandern is in the Eichsfeld, the broader Thuringia region encompasses parts of the UNESCO Biosphere Reserve Rhön. Routes that ascend to higher viewpoints in the area, such as the Nüssekuppe, may offer glimpses towards the characteristic 'land of open vistas' of the Rhön, known for its unwooded peaks and expansive views.
